Vibranium Labs Secures $4.6 Million in Seed Funding



Vibranium Labs has recently announced the successful closure of a funding round worth $4.6 million aimed at advancing its flagship product, Vibe AI. This innovative tool is engineered to operate as the world's first AI Site Reliability Engineer (AI SRE), drastically enhancing incident management across myriad industries. With AI-driven capacities, Vibe AI empowers organizations to maintain operational resilience by efficiently identifying, triaging, and resolving IT-related incidents and outages around the clock.

The seed funding round was led by prominent investors, including Calibrate Ventures and Mirae Asset, underscoring the growing interest in advanced incident management solutions powered by AI. The influx of capital will facilitate Vibranium Labs' continued product innovation and the expansion of its engineering and sales teams, further solidifying its industry partnerships where service uptime is crucial, such as in finance, healthcare, entertainment, e-commerce, and defense.

Vibe AI functions as an always-on digital engineer, poised to transform the way incidents are handled within technical operations. Traditionally, incident response involved a situation where senior engineers are disrupted in the early hours of the morning, navigating fragmented systems to address outages. Sang Lee, Co-Founder and CEO of Vibranium Labs, articulated the inefficiency of this approach, emphasizing how it leads to prolonged recovery times and heightened stress for engineering teams.

Contrastingly, Vibe AI maintains a proactive stance. By integrating seamlessly into existing incident management frameworks, it conducts preliminary triage and gathers contextual information across various tools. It can make intelligent suggestions for addressing incidents even before human engineers connect to the system, thus allowing teams to focus on strategic problem-solving rather than reactive firefighting.

The effectiveness of Vibe AI is not just theoretical; it is currently operational with numerous Fortune 1000 companies and other mission-critical enterprises that leverage its capabilities to significantly reduce mean time to resolution (MTTR) by up to 85%. The utilization of Vibe AI allows businesses not only to protect revenue through enhanced uptime but also fosters trust in the reliability of their digital infrastructure.

Vibranium Labs’ recognition as one of AWS's inaugural agentic AI partners further validates its position in the market. The company's selection into AWS's first-ever agentic AI marketplace places it alongside heavyweights like Salesforce and Splunk, marking its commitment to providing cutting-edge solutions for enterprise clients.
